Understanding Curve and Cardano ?

Curve Finance is a leading decentralized exchange (DEX) specializing in stablecoin trading, renowned for its efficient StableSwap algorithm that minimizes slippage and trading fees. Its architecture has evolved to include Next-Generation pools with built-in oracles, dynamic fees, and gas optimizations, making it a hub for liquidity providers and institutional collaborations such as BlackRock and Ethena. Curve's surge in user adoption and total value locked (TVL) reflects its central role in DeFi liquidity and asset issuance strategies.

Cardano, on the other hand, is a comprehensive blockchain platform distinguished by its layered architecture—comprising the Settlement Layer for handling ADA transactions and the Computation Layer for smart contracts. Developed under the leadership of Ethereum co-founder Charles Hoskinson, Cardano emphasizes scalability, security, and environmental sustainability through its proof-of-stake Ouroboros consensus. Its strategic partnerships, high transaction throughput, and innovative off-chain solutions position it as a foundational platform for decentralized applications and enterprise use cases.

While Curve excels in providing specialized liquidity pools for stablecoins and facilitating seamless DeFi transactions, Cardano offers a broad, flexible infrastructure for building decentralized services across multiple sectors, including finance, government, and academia. Both platforms have seen significant growth—Curve with its increasing TVL and institutional integration, and Cardano with transaction volume milestones and strategic collaborations—highlighting their importance in the crypto ecosystem.

Key Differences Between Curve and Cardano

Core Functionality

  • Curve: Curve is primarily a specialized decentralized exchange designed for stablecoin trading and liquidity pools, offering optimized swaps with minimal slippage through its innovative StableSwap algorithm. Its pools are built for high efficiency and low-cost transactions, making it a preferred choice for stablecoin liquidity providers and institutions seeking stable asset liquidity.
  • Cardano: Cardano functions as a full-fledged blockchain platform with a layered architecture that supports a wide array of decentralized applications, smart contracts, and enterprise solutions. Its focus is on scalability, security, and sustainability, enabling developers to build complex dApps and integrate with various sectors beyond just DeFi.

Architecture

  • Curve: Curve utilizes a specialized pool architecture with built-in oracles, dynamic fee mechanisms, and gas optimizations, designed specifically for stable asset swaps. Its infrastructure is optimized for high liquidity, low slippage, and institutional-grade stability, which has been enhanced with the introduction of Next-Generation pools in 2024.
  • Cardano: Cardano's architecture is divided into the Settlement Layer and the Computation Layer, facilitating transaction processing and smart contract execution separately. This modular design enhances flexibility for upgrades and scaling, supports multiple programming languages, and emphasizes formal verification for security.

Market Position & Adoption

  • Curve: Curve has experienced exponential growth in 2024, with its TVL surpassing $2.4 billion and a user base doubling to over 60,000. Its collaborations with institutional players like BlackRock and Ethena underscore its importance in DeFi liquidity and asset issuance, and its revenue continues to grow through fee-based models and new product launches like Llamalend and crvUSD.
  • Cardano: Cardano boasts a transaction volume exceeding 30 million transactions in Q1 2024, a robust community with over 500,000 members, and strategic partnerships with governments and corporations worldwide. Its focus on scalability, off-chain solutions, and layered upgrades positions it as a versatile platform for decentralized services beyond DeFi.

Use Cases & Applications

  • Curve: Curve's primary use cases include stablecoin trading, liquidity provision, and institutional asset backing through collaborations with entities like BlackRock. It also supports borrowing and lending via Llamalend, and its pools underpin a variety of stable assets and tokenized real-world assets.
  • Cardano: Cardano supports a broad spectrum of applications, from decentralized finance to supply chain management, identity verification, and government projects. Its smart contract capabilities via Plutus and Marlowe enable complex financial instruments, and its layered design allows developers to innovate with off-chain computations and interoperability.

Unique Selling Points & Limitations

  • Curve: Curve's unique StableSwap architecture provides ultra-efficient stablecoin swaps with minimal slippage and gas costs, making it a leader in DeFi liquidity pools. Its recent NG pools and institutional integrations further strengthen its position, although its specialization limits broader platform utility.
  • Cardano: Cardano's layered architecture, formal verification, and proof-of-stake consensus offer high security, scalability, and environmental sustainability. Its flexibility for building diverse decentralized applications and ongoing development of sidechains and interoperability features make it a comprehensive blockchain platform, though its adoption in mainstream enterprise remains an ongoing process.

Conclusion: Curve vs Cardano

Curve and Cardano serve distinct yet complementary roles within the crypto ecosystem. Curve's focus on stablecoin liquidity and low-slippage swaps makes it a backbone for DeFi asset markets, especially appealing to institutional users and liquidity providers seeking efficiency and stability.

Meanwhile, Cardano's layered architecture and smart contract capabilities position it as a versatile platform for building a wide array of decentralized solutions, from finance to governance. Its emphasis on scalability, security, and interoperability suggests a promising outlook for developers and enterprises aiming to leverage blockchain technology for real-world applications.
